Another new player in the Smartphone arena – Asus has announced a QWERTY based Windows Mobile Smartphone. It looks to be a little thicker than some of the other keyboard devices on the market today. Hopefully it will make up for that when we see more info on the specs of the device. I like the keypad layout and the space between the keys.
